ビットコイン(BTC)の採掘(マイニング)とは何か?
ビットコインは、2009年にサトシ・ナカモトと名乗る人物またはグループによって考案された、分散型デジタル通貨です。その根幹をなす技術の一つが「採掘(マイニング)」と呼ばれるプロセスです。本稿では、ビットコインの採掘について、その仕組み、目的、歴史的背景、技術的詳細、そして将来展望について、専門的な視点から詳細に解説します。
1. 採掘の基本的な仕組み
ビットコインの採掘は、新しいトランザクションを検証し、ブロックチェーンに追加する作業です。ブロックチェーンは、ビットコインのすべてのトランザクション記録を保持する公開分散型台帳であり、その安全性を確保するために採掘が存在します。採掘者は、複雑な数学的問題を解くことで、新しいブロックを生成する権利を得ます。この問題を解くためには、高度な計算能力が必要であり、専用のハードウェア(ASICなど)が用いられます。
具体的には、採掘者は「ナンス」と呼ばれる値を変更しながら、ハッシュ関数(SHA-256)を用いてブロックヘッダーをハッシュ化します。目標値よりも小さいハッシュ値を見つけることができれば、その採掘者は新しいブロックを生成し、ブロックチェーンに追加する権利を得ます。このプロセスは「プルーフ・オブ・ワーク(PoW)」と呼ばれ、ビットコインのセキュリティの基盤となっています。
2. 採掘の目的と役割
ビットコインの採掘には、主に以下の3つの目的と役割があります。
- トランザクションの検証と記録: 採掘者は、ビットコインネットワーク上で発生したトランザクションを検証し、不正なトランザクションを排除します。検証されたトランザクションは、ブロックチェーンに記録され、改ざんが困難になります。
- 新しいビットコインの発行: 新しいブロックを生成した採掘者には、報酬として新しいビットコインが与えられます。この報酬は、採掘者の活動を促進し、ネットワークのセキュリティを維持するためのインセンティブとなります。
- ネットワークのセキュリティ維持: プルーフ・オブ・ワークの仕組みにより、悪意のある攻撃者がブロックチェーンを改ざんすることは非常に困難になります。採掘者の計算能力がネットワーク全体に分散されているため、単一の攻撃者がネットワークを支配することは現実的に不可能です。
3. 採掘の歴史的背景
ビットコインの採掘は、ビットコインの誕生当初から存在していました。当初は、CPUを使用して採掘が可能でしたが、競争が激化するにつれて、GPU、FPGA、そして最終的にはASICと呼ばれる専用ハードウェアが使用されるようになりました。ASICは、ビットコインの採掘に特化したハードウェアであり、CPUやGPUよりもはるかに高い計算能力を発揮します。
初期の採掘者たちは、ビットコインの可能性を信じ、ネットワークの発展に貢献しました。しかし、採掘の難易度は時間とともに上昇し、個人が採掘を行うことは困難になりました。その結果、大規模な採掘プールが登場し、複数の採掘者が協力してブロックを生成するようになりました。
4. 採掘の技術的詳細
ビットコインの採掘には、以下の技術的な要素が関わっています。
- ハッシュ関数(SHA-256): ブロックヘッダーをハッシュ化するために使用される暗号学的関数です。SHA-256は、入力データから固定長のハッシュ値を生成し、入力データが少しでも変更されると、ハッシュ値が大きく変化するという特徴があります。
- ナンス: 採掘者が変更する値であり、ハッシュ値が目標値よりも小さくなるように調整されます。
- ブロックヘッダー: ブロックのメタデータであり、前のブロックのハッシュ値、トランザクションのルートハッシュ、タイムスタンプ、難易度ターゲット、ナンスなどが含まれます。
- 難易度調整: ビットコインネットワークは、約2週間ごとにブロック生成時間を一定に保つために、採掘の難易度を自動的に調整します。
- 採掘プール: 複数の採掘者が協力してブロックを生成し、報酬を分配する仕組みです。
5. 採掘の経済的側面
ビットコインの採掘は、経済的な側面も重要です。採掘者は、ハードウェアの購入費用、電気代、冷却費用などのコストを負担する必要があります。採掘の収益性は、ビットコインの価格、採掘の難易度、電気代などの要因によって変動します。
採掘の収益性を評価するためには、ハッシュレート(計算能力)、消費電力、電気料金、ビットコインの価格などを考慮する必要があります。採掘者は、これらの要素を総合的に判断し、採掘を行うかどうかを決定します。
6. 採掘の環境問題
ビットコインの採掘は、大量の電力を消費するため、環境問題が懸念されています。特に、石炭などの化石燃料を使用して発電している地域では、二酸化炭素の排出量が増加し、地球温暖化を加速させる可能性があります。
この問題に対処するため、再生可能エネルギー(太陽光、風力、水力など)を使用して採掘を行う取り組みが進められています。また、より効率的な採掘ハードウェアの開発や、プルーフ・オブ・ステーク(PoS)などの代替コンセンサスアルゴリズムの導入も検討されています。
7. 採掘の将来展望
ビットコインの採掘は、今後も進化を続けると考えられます。ASICの性能向上、再生可能エネルギーの利用拡大、そしてプルーフ・オブ・ステークなどの新しいコンセンサスアルゴリズムの導入などが、その主な方向性となるでしょう。
プルーフ・オブ・ステークは、プルーフ・オブ・ワークと比較して、電力消費量が少なく、環境負荷が低いという利点があります。しかし、セキュリティや分散性などの面で課題も存在するため、慎重な検討が必要です。
また、ビットコインの半減期(約4年に一度、採掘報酬が半分になるイベント)は、採掘の収益性に大きな影響を与えます。半減期後には、採掘の難易度が上昇し、採掘コストが増加する可能性があります。そのため、採掘者は、常に効率的な採掘方法を模索し、コスト削減に取り組む必要があります。
8. まとめ
ビットコインの採掘は、ビットコインネットワークのセキュリティを維持し、新しいビットコインを発行するための重要なプロセスです。採掘の仕組み、目的、歴史的背景、技術的詳細、経済的側面、環境問題、そして将来展望を理解することは、ビットコインの全体像を把握する上で不可欠です。今後、ビットコインの採掘は、技術革新や環境問題への対応を通じて、さらなる進化を遂げることが期待されます。ビットコインの持続可能な発展のためには、採掘者、開発者、そして社会全体が協力し、より効率的で環境に優しい採掘方法を模索していく必要があります。